Foundation and Leveling Requirements

A solid, level base is non-negotiable for any above-ground model. Most installations require a certified level foundation — typically 6–8 inches thick with rebar or wire mesh. This prevents shifting, cracking, or equipment strain during freeze-thaw cycles. A pool installation contractor will ensure your base meets manufacturer and municipal specs for long-term safety.

Prevent DIY gravel or paver pads — they fail under heavy loads and void warranties.

Essential Service Links

Proper drain access and electrical rough-in are critical for safe, efficient operation. A qualified technician handles all connections to your heater and ensures compliance with Alberta’s electrical code. Most units require a dedicated 50-60 amp circuit and hardwired service — never use an extension cord.

Smart monitoring rely on proper wiring, so precision here means trouble-free performance for years.

Access Routes and Delivery Logistics

Even the best hydrotherapy unit can’t be installed if it can’t reach your yard. Delivery often requires a crane, forklift, or heavy-duty trailer — so your access route must be at least 8 feet wide and free of low wires, trees, or tight turns. A pool installation contractor will survey the path and schedule delivery for minimal disruption. Consider temporary fence removal or gate adjustments to enable placement.

Skimmer Service

Fresh water starts with a regularly serviced filter. Rinse your pre-filter screen every few swims depending on season. Over time, mineral buildup means full replacement — typically every 18 months.

  • Tool-free removal and rinse process
  • High-flow filters available from trusted installer
  • Reduce strain on pump with clean filters
